WebThe git checkout command is used to update the state of the repository to a specific point in the projects history. When passed with a branch name, it lets you switch between branches. git checkout hotfix Internally, all the above command does is move HEAD to a different branch and update the working directory to match. WebMar 8, 2013 · "To check out" means that you take any given commit from the repository and re-create the state of the associated file and directory tree in the working directory.
